Bucharest’s iconic Arch of Triumph, a symbol of the Romanian capital and the country’s victory in World War I, will once ...
The authorities in Bran, central Romania, recently revealed a plan to transform the central park into an attractive spot for leisure activities that would benefit from the proximity to the small ...